#0736cf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0736cf is composed of 2.7% red, 21.2%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.6% cyan, 73.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 225.9 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 42%. #0736cf color hex could be obtained by blending #0e6cff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#0736cf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010511 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0736cf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6a6c is the less saturated color, while #0736cf is the most saturated one.
